meaw

Etymology 1

[edit]

Verb

[edit]

meaw (third-person singular simple present meaws, present participle meawing, simple past and past participle meawed)

  1. Dated form of meow.

Noun

[edit]

meaw (plural meaws)

  1. Dated form of meow.
    • 1881, Belgravia, volume 45:
      Was it a meaw I heard, and a scratching, or was it only the wind []

Etymology 2

[edit]

Noun

[edit]

meaw (plural meaws or meawes)

  1. Obsolete form of mew (seagull).
